Transaction 42b52402cecf86c4cc57c17c974ec812da4b07725fbfb7b6f95b9091d20a00b6

1 Input
2 Outputs
  • 42b52402cecf86c4cc57c17c974ec812da4b07725fbfb7b6f95b9091d20a00b6:0
  • value  166091
    address  3FEaSJ9yBZkY6kuiavCs5sRESaVsSe44dZ
  • 42b52402cecf86c4cc57c17c974ec812da4b07725fbfb7b6f95b9091d20a00b6:1
  • value  57845978
    address  3AtciwCdT8pDS4mmdNYoUVAaUcFMdEKLEr